Tameryraptor markgrafi is a significant dinosaur that was named by an even more significant paleontologist. But only photos and a braincase of it remain.

Dinosaur of the day Dakotadon, an ornithopod that was originally pronounced the "first species from the United States that can be clearly referred to the European genus Iguanodon".

In dinosaur news this week:

  • The newly named Tameryraptor is such a significant find that it could be considered the original Carcharodontosaurus
